WebMay 8, 2024 · In March 2024, ransomware struck the city's 911 dispatch system, but Baltimore's IT office managed to isolate the threat and avoid a disruption of critical services. The attack had a negative impact on the real estate market as property transfers could not be completed digitally due to the system being down, as the city's card payment system and debt checking application were rendered inaccessible. In addition, city employees were unable to use their email system and resorted to creating Gmail accounts as workaround.
